		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Hi Chelle,</p>
<p>1.)<br />
You&#8217;ll need to ask your boyfriend how he accesses the Internet at his dorm. If they have a LAN cable, he can connect the packet8 device to the LAN cable. If they use WiFi (more likely), he will need to use some additional hardware to pick-up the WiFi signal and connect it to the packet8 device via LAN. I don&#8217;t know the details, but your boyfriend&#8217;s neighborhood techie might be able to figure it out.</p>
<p>Here&#8217;s a caveat, though. Voice quality is affected by the type of Internet connection. If your boyfriend is using a public internet connection, there&#8217;s a good chance that the voice quality will be low. Over here at my brother&#8217;s office, they attempted two different VOIP services and each service was affecting the other on his private Internet connection. This is more likely to happen with a public internet connection.</p>
<p>2.)<br />
I believe activation needs to be done in the US. And I think it&#8217;s better that way so that you have access to the packet8 customer support to answer your questions before you send over the hardware to the PHilippines.</p>
